#include <config.h>

/* Specification.  */
#include "unistr.h"

int
u16_strmblen (const uint16_t *s)
{
  /* Keep in sync with unistr.h and u16-mbtouc-aux.c.  */
  uint16_t c = *s;

  if (c < 0xd800 || c >= 0xe000)
    return (c != 0 ? 1 : 0);
  if (c < 0xdc00)
    {
      if (s[1] >= 0xdc00 && s[1] < 0xe000)
        return 2;
    }
  /* invalid or incomplete multibyte character */
  return -1;
}
